Who was the teacher who set up a school where Jewish scholars could study which helped preserve Jewish traditions?

The answer that you're looking for is "Rabbi Johanan ben Zakkai." However, there is a mistake in your question, or its perceived answer. Rabbi Johanan did not found the Torah-academy in Yavneh. Rather, it had already existed, and he bolstered it with hundreds of additional disciples.

What Jewish group wanted to cooperate with the Romans to keep peace?

The Torah-sages, under Rabbi Johanan ben Zakkai, counseled against rebellion, while the hot-headed Zealots went ahead and fomented rebellion anyway (Talmud, Gittin 56a). See also:Reasons for the DestructionJewish groups at that time

Who was Johanna ben zakkai?

Yochanan ben zakkai was the youngest and most distinguished disciple of rabbi hellil. He has been called the Father of wisdom and the father of generations (of scholars) because he ensured the continuation of Jewish scholarship after Jerusalem fell to Rome in 70 ce

Where did Rabbi Yochanon ben Zakkai and his disciples settle?

Rabban (Rabbi) Yochanan ben Zakkai (1st century CE) lived his entire life in the Holy Land, in Jerusalem, and later in a town called B'ror Chail (in his last years). His chief disciples were Rabbi Eliezer and Rabbi Yehoshua, the teachers of Rabbi Akiva. Rabbi Eliezer settled in Lod, while Rabbi Yehoshua lived in Pekiin. Rabbi Yochanan ben Zakkai was also famous for creating the Yeshivah at Yavneh (Talmud, Gittin 56b).
